Yzerfontein Facts
| Area | 3.5 km² |
| Population | 1,042 |
| Male Population | 507 (48.6%) |
| Female Population | 535 (51.4%) |
| Population change (1975 to 2020) | +814.0% |
| Population change (2000 to 2020) | +83.8% |
| Median Age | 57.8 years (Male: 57.7, Female: 57.8) |
| Neighborhoods | Yzerfontein, Pearl Bay, Vierfontein, Western Cape |

Yzerfontein Population
Years 1975 to 2030
| Data | 1975 | 1990 | 2000 | 2015 | 2020 | 2025* | 2030* |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 114 | 310 | 567 | 1,097 | 1,042 | 1,168 | 1,318 |
| Population Density | 32.6 / km² | 88.6 / km² | 162 / km² | 313.4 / km² | 297.7 / km² | 333.7 / km² | 376.6 / km² |

Yzerfontein Median Age
Median Age: 57.8 years
| Location | Median Age | Median Age (Female) | Median Age (Male)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Yzerfontein | 57.8 yrs | 57.8 yrs | 57.7 yrs |
| Western Cape | 28.2 yrs | 28.8 yrs | 27.7 yrs |
| South Africa | 25.4 yrs | 26.3 yrs | 24.5 yrs |

Natural Hazards Risk
Relative risk out of 10
| Hazard | Risk Level |
|---|---|
| Drought | High (8) |
| Flood | Medium (4) |
